> Какие факторы в работе для вас неприемлемы (Node.js, JavaScript)

Уровень: middle · Роль: frontend · Категория: Технические вопросы

Компании: ЭНИРАН

Стек: Node.js, JavaScript

> Пример ответа

Для меня как фронтенд-разработчика на JavaScript и Node.js неприемлемы следующие факторы:

  1. Отсутствие четких требований и частые изменения в процессе разработки - это приводит к бесконечным переделкам и снижению качества кода. Особенно критично, когда требования меняются без предварительного обсуждения с командой.
  2. Игнорирование code review и тестирования - если в команде не принято проверять код коллег или писать тесты (unit, интеграционные), это ведет к накоплению технического долга и багам в продакшене.
  3. Микроменеджмент - когда каждый шаг контролируется, а разработчику не доверяют принимать решения по архитектуре или выбору инструментов (например, какой фреймворк или библиотеку использовать для Node.js).
  4. Отсутствие документации и знаний в команде - если нет документации по API, компонентам или процессам, а новые разработчики вынуждены разбираться методом тыка, это сильно замедляет работу.
  5. Неадекватные дедлайны без учета сложности задач - например, требование сделать сложную интеграцию с бэкендом за один день без учета времени на отладку.
  6. Токсичная атмосфера - критика вместо конструктивной обратной связи, обвинения в ошибках без анализа причин, игнорирование мнения разработчика.

Эти факторы мешают продуктивной работе и росту как специалиста, поэтому я стараюсь избегать таких условий.

> ГОТОВЫ К СЛЕДУЮЩЕМУ СОБЕСЕДОВАНИЮ?

Запустите тренировочную сессию с ИИ и получите детальную обратную связь, чтобы увереннее проходить реальные интервью